Preparation and Characterization of a Dip‐Coated SnO2 Film for Transparent Electrodes for Transmissive Electrochromic Devices

Paulo OliviErnesto C. PereiraE. LongoJosé A. VarellaL.O.S. Bulhões

Year: 1993 Journal:   Journal of The Electrochemical Society Vol: 140 (5)Pages: L81-L82   Publisher: Institute of Physics

Abstract

A new method for the synthesis of is proposed and thin films are prepared by a dip‐coating method. In the present paper we report that these films exhibit a reversible electrochemical insertion of lithium ions while maintaining high optical transmissivity. These films can be used as transparent counterelectrodes in electrochromic transmissive devices and in gas sensors.
